很多站长朋友们都不太清楚php数组中有quot,今天小编就来给大家整理php数组中有quot,希望对各位有所帮助,具体内容如下:
本文目录一览: 1、 php中数组的分类有哪两种? 2、 怎样php去掉数组中的双引号? 3、 PHP中数组的问题 4、 PHP数组的三种定义格式是怎么样的? 5、 php 中 判断数组中是否有值 6、 用自己的语言说出php中数组的常用函数和用法? php中数组的分类有哪两种?1、索引数组
有两种创建索引数组的方法:
索引是自动分配的(索引从 0 开始):
$cars=array("porsche","BMW","Volvo");
2、关联数组
关联数组是使用您分配给数组的指定键的数组。
有两种创建关联数组的方法:
$age=array("Bill"=>"35","Steve"=>"37","Elon"=>"43");
扩展资料
实用函数——
有相当多的实用函数作用于数组,参见数组函数一节。
注: unset() 函数允许取消一个数组中的键名。要注意数组将不会重建索引。
<?php
$a = array( 1 => 'one', 2 => 'two', 3 => 'three' );
unset( $a[2] );
/* 将产生一个数组,定义为
$a = array( 1=>'one', 3=>'three');
而不是
$a = array( 1 => 'one', 2 => 'three');
*/
$b = array_values($a);
// Now $b is array(0 => 'one', 1 =>'three')
?>
foreach 控制结构是专门用于数组的。它提供了一个简单的方法来遍历数组。
怎样php去掉数组中的双引号?其实有引号就是代表的字符串,你可以遍历数组,然后把值变成int类型就可以了
PHP中数组的问题那就用一种新手的思维模式告诉你,如下:
// 以下变量都属于超级全局变量(PHP以变量作用域的权限来分可以分为3类,1)普通变量2)全局变量3)超级全局变量)超级全局变量都是数组
$GLOBALS // 所有全局变量数组(这个变量可以用来访问脚本的任何一个地方,用户可以自定义变量里的内容,注意他是数组格式$GLOBALS['key'],包括:类方法,函数等等但是不能跨页面)
$_SERVER // 服务器环境变量数组(用户无需自定义,他内部存储了大量的服务器信息的内容,可以通过相应的下标来访问,如:$_SERVER['PHP_SELF'],当前脚本文件名称)
$_GET // 通过GET 方法传递给该脚本的变量数组(通过浏览器地址栏?后面的内容来接收值,例如:index.php?page=1,那么$_GET['page']就等于1)
$_POST // 通过POST 方法传递给该脚本的变量数组(一般用于表单的提交,当然form标记的method的属性必须是post,他默认是get,例如:<input name="username" type="text" />,那么当表单提交以后,$_POST['username']就可以获取到用户输入的值)
$_COOKIE // cookie 变量数组(他的作用很大,该变量会在客户机中存储cookie文件,用来区别其他用户,他主要用于网站的会话控制区分用户,可以跨页面访问)
$_FILES // 与文件上载相关的变量数组(当你的表单<input type="file" name="upload" />存在的时候,注意类型必须是file,表示上传域,那么当表单提交以后可以通过$_FILES['upload']来访问其上传的内容)
$_ENV // 环境变量数组(与$_SERVER变量类似,用法也一样)
$_REQUEST // 所有用户输入的变量数组(他是$_GET与$_POST的集合,就是说不管你的表单是get提交还是post提交,都可以用$_REQUEST的方式来接收)
$_SESSION // 会话变量数组(与cookie类似,也是用来区分用户会话控制,但是他的session文件存储在服务端)
如果还有问题,欢迎追问~
PHP数组的三种定义格式是怎么样的?格式就是这三种啊
1. $array = ("value1","value2"……)
2. $array[key] = "value";
3. $array(key1 => value1, key2 => value2……)
php 中 判断数组中是否有值in_array() 函数在数组中搜索给定的值。 语法 in_array(value,array,type) 参数 value 必需。规定要在数组搜索的值。 array 必需。规定要搜索的数组。 type 可眩如果设置该参数为 true,则检查搜索的数据与数组的值的类型是否相同。
用自己的语言说出php中数组的常用函数和用法?array_filter : 过滤数组中的无效元素,可以使用回调函数过滤
array_map : 使用回调函数依次处理所有元素
implode: 将一维数组转为特定符号隔开的字符串,
explode: 将特定符号隔开的字符串转为一维数组
sort /ksort: 将数组进行升序排序
array_unique: 将数组元素去重
array_values: 取数组的值,重新组成新数组
array_pop: 取数组末尾元素并删除(队列)
array_push:将一个元素插入数组末尾(队列)
array_sum:统计数组元素的和
array_column:将二维数组中的指定KEY取出组成一个一维数组
网页链接
关于php数组中有quot的介绍到此就结束了,不知道本篇文章是否对您有帮助呢?如果你还想了解更多此类信息,记得收藏关注本站,我们会不定期更新哦。
查看更多关于php数组中有quot php中数组可以使用哪些键名的详细内容...